Principal Duties and Responsibilities
- Assist with all store functions and day-to-day store activities as directed by the Store Manager.
- Able to perform all opening and closing procedures in the absence of the Store Manager.
- Assist the Store Manager in protecting and securing all company assets, including store cash.
- Adhere to all policies and procedures including safety guidelines.
- Maintain a professional and friendly environment with customers, subordinates, and supervisors.
- Maintain all areas of the store, including the stockroom and sales floor, to company standards, including recovery.
- When the Store Manager is not on the premises, have direct supervisory responsibility for all hourly Associates.
- Process all SSC Corporate directives including Pull and Hold/Destroy, Task Compliance, Key Survey information, and other store activity communications as delegated by the Store Manager.
- Assist the Store Manager with receipt and return of DSD merchandise, following VIP and DSD Policies and Procedures.
- Assist the Store Manager in ensuring proper staffing coverage daily.
- Assist in managing cashiering activities to ensure all cash handling practices & guidelines are followed.
- Support promotional effectiveness of store fixtures and displays.
- Help manage sales effectiveness of seasonal areas and coordinate signage in the store.
- Assist with merchandise receipt, return, and processing of damaged goods daily.
- Assist Store Manager with creating weekly schedules.
- Help manage store supplies and control expenses.
- Assist with merchandising and maintaining checkout areas to maximize impulse sales.
- Ensure coolers and displays are refilled daily, including promotional items.
Minimum Requirements/Qualifications
- Prefer prior retail and management experience.
- Strong communication, interpersonal, and written skills.
- Ability to lift, bend, and transport merchandise weighing up to 50 lbs.
- Ability to work in a high-energy team environment.
